The Basic Education Certificate Examination (BECE) is an examination that qualifies students for admission to secondary and vocational schools in Ghana. Every year, students who have completed three years of high school take these exams. BECE results are published later and there is a system to access these results.

The West African Examination Council (WAEC) releases BECE results every year. Once the results are released, students are placed in Senior High Schools (SHS) if they meet the admission criteria. Here’s everything you need to know about BECE results.

BECE results: everything you need to know

Both Ghanaian and non-Ghanaian candidates are eligible for the BECE selection process. BECE results are usually released after at least two months of students taking the exams. The results are released by the West African Examinations Council (WAEC).

How to Check BECE Results Online

You need a phone or computer and reliable internet to use the online BECE result checker. Before you can complete the process, you need to get a WAEC Result Check Scratch Card from an accredited dealer in Ghana. Some of the authorized dealers are Ghana Post, Apex Bank and Lismic Consult Limited. Then follow the steps below.

  • Choose the BECE (School and Private) option. You will be redirected to the eResults checker.
  • Fill in your personal details on the page that appears on the screen. The details you need to enter are your index number, school, exam year, serial number and PIN. The serial number is located on the back of the scratch card.
  • Confirm you are not a robot and click send.
  • Wait for your WAEC BECE results to be displayed in the pop-up window. This may take a few seconds.

How to Check BECE Results on Phone Using USSD

You can check JHS BECE results through USSD on any mobile network. Follow the steps below to complete the process.

  • Dial the code to check your BECE results ie *899*550# (on any network).
  • Select BECE Results Checker.
  • Confirm the price and description, then choose option 1.
  • Authorize payment using Mobile Money.
  • Wait for your SMS verification card with instructions to check your results.
  • Follow the instructions given to view your results.

How to buy BECE result checker through MTN MoMo

MTN MoMo users have an alternative way to purchase their result checker. Follow the steps below if you are an MTN subscriber.

  • Dial *170# on your mobile phone.
  • Choose option 2 i.e. MoMo Pay & Pay Bill
  • Choose option 2 again, i.e. Pay Bill
  • Choose option 5 i.e. General Payment
  • Enter the payment code: FAST, followed by the amount, which is 25.
  • Enter your reference, which is BECE
  • Then approve the transaction
  • Wait for verification card and instructions to check your results via SMS.

NB: If you have been wondering how to check your BECE results on your phone without a scratch card, please follow the steps above if you are an MTN MoMo user. Alternatively, use the USSD code method described above from any network.

When will the BECE results be published?

The BECE 2024 results were released in October. Certificates of successful candidates are usually produced within one month of the publication of the results.

What is BECE in Ghana?

BECE is the primary examination to qualify students for admission to secondary and vocational schools in Ghana. Nigeria also offers BECE.

What is the best score in BECE?

The highest raw score a candidate can achieve in BECE is 600. This is the sum of perfect scores in a candidate’s three best core subjects and three best elective subjects. It is important to note that the specific raw score to pass a subject may change from year to year depending on the difficulty of the exams.

What subjects are tested in BECE?

BECE exams assess English language, mathematics, integrated science, social studies, religious and moral education and French. Elective subjects include Ghanaian language, vocational technology, IT, creative arts and design and Arabic.
